- •Оглавление
- •Обозначения и сокращения
- •Введение
- •Цель курсового проектирования
- •Исследование функций и целей организации
- •Постановка задачи
- •Анализ возможностей методологии и инструментальных средств проектирования заданной ис
- •1. Создание модели ис AllFusion Process Modeler 4.1 (Bpwin 4.1)
- •1.1 Создание модели в стандартеIdef0
- •1.2 Дополнение созданной модели процессов организационными диаграммами
- •1.2.1 Диаграммы потоков данных (DataFlowDiagramming)
- •1.2.2 Диаграммы методологииIdef3 (WorkflowDiagramming)
- •2. Создание модели данных с помощьюAllFusionErwinDataModeler4.1 Информационная модель в нотации idef1x
- •3. Поиск и исправление ошибок с помощьюErwinExaminer
- •4. Модели в нотации языкаUml
- •4.1 Диаграмма размещения (Deploymentdiagram)
- •4.2 Диаграмма компонентов (Component diagram)
- •4.3 Диаграмма классов (Classdiagram)
- •5. Связь с субдAccess
- •6. Разработка экранных форм
- •Заключение
- •Список используемой литературы
Оглавление
Обозначения и сокращения 2
Введение 3
Цель курсового проектирования 3
Анализ возможностей методологии и инструментальных средств проектирования заданной ИС 4
1. Создание модели ИС 5
AllFusion Process Modeler 4.1 (Bpwin 4.1) 5
1.1 Создание модели в стандарте IDEF0 5
1.2 Дополнение созданной модели процессов организационными диаграммами 16
1.2.1 Диаграммы потоков данных (Data Flow Diagramming) 16
1.2.2 Диаграммы методологии IDEF3 (Workflow Diagramming) 19
2. Создание модели данных с помощью AllFusion Erwin Data Modeler 4.1 22
3. Поиск и исправление ошибок с помощью Erwin Examiner 26
4. Модели в нотации языка UML 31
4.1 Диаграмма размещения (Deployment diagram) 31
4.2 Диаграмма компонентов (Component diagram) 32
4.3 Диаграмма классов (Class diagram) 33
5. Связь с СУБД Access 34
6. Разработка экранных форм 36
Заключение 42
Список используемой литературы 43
Обозначения и сокращения
В настоящей работе применяются следующие термины с соответствующими определениями:
ИС - информационная система;
БД - база данных;
СУБД - система управления баз данных.
Введение
С развитием информационных технологий компьютеры, с их расширенными функциональными возможностями, активно применяются в различных сферах человеческой деятельности, связанных с обработкой информации, представлением данных.
В современном обществе, которое функционирует в жестких рыночных условиях, своевременная обработка информации способствует совершенствованию организации производства, оперативному и долгосрочному планированию, прогнозированию и анализу хозяйственной деятельности, что позволяет успешно конкурировать на рынке. Каждая организация стремиться минимизировать затраты времени, материальных, трудовых ресурсов в ходе своей деятельности и упростить процесс обработки информации. Эти задачи можно решить с использованием автоматизированных информационных систем.
Использование баз данных и информационных систем становится неотъемлемой составляющей деловой деятельности современного человека и функционирования преуспевающих организаций. В связи с этим большую актуальность приобретает освоение принципов построения и эффективного применения соответствующих технологий и программных продуктов: систем управления базами данных, CASE-средств автоматизации проектирования и других.
Цель курсового проектирования
Целью данного курсового проекта является разработка информационной системы “Гостиница”.
Исследование функций и целей организации
В данном курсовом проекте в качестве исследуемой организации рассматривается гостиница, которая предоставляет номера постояльцам с целью получения прибыли.
Гостиница оказывает следующие услуги:
предоставление номеров,
их обслуживание,
администрирование телефонных переговоров.
Средства автоматизации предназначены для эффективной работы с информацией.
Постановка задачи
Разработать в архитектуре “клиент - сервер” ИС, предназначенную для гостиницы, БД информационной системы, содержащую сведения о номерах гостиницы: категория, количество мест, стоимость проживания за сутки.
Информационная система автоматизирует резервирование номеров и регистрацию новоприбывших постояльцев (фамилия, имя, отчество, сведения о документе, удостоверяющем личность, место постоянного жительства, номер апартамента, дата въезда, дата выезда), ведет учет платежей за проживание и за телефонные переговоры, облегчает учет занятых, зарезервированных и свободных на данный момент апартаментов гостиницы.
Прототип ИС разработать средствами MSAccessиMSSQL.
При разработке использовать результаты инфологического проектирования.